2023-05-06board: rockchip: add Anbernic RGXX3 Series DevicesChris Morgan
The Anbernic RGxx3 is a "pseudo-device" that encompasses the following devices: - Anbernic RG353M - Anbernic RG353P - Anbernic RG353V - Anbernic RG353VS - Anbernic RG503 The rk3566-anbernic-rgxx3.dtsi is synced with upstream Linux, but rk3566-anbernic-rgxx3.dts is a U-Boot specific devicetree that is used for all RGxx3 devices. Via the board.c file, the bootloader automatically sets the correct fdtfile, board, and board_name environment variables so that the correct devicetree can be passed to Linux. It is also possible to simply hard-code a single devicetree in the boot.scr file and use that to load Linux as well. The common specifications for each device are: - Rockchip RK3566 SoC - 2 external SDMMC slots - 1 USB-C host port, 1 USB-C peripheral port - 1 mini-HDMI output - MIPI-DSI based display panel - ADC controlled joysticks with a GPIO mux - GPIO buttons - A PWM controlled vibrator - An ADC controlled button All of the common features are defined in the devicetree synced from upstream Linux. TODO: DSI panel auto-detection for the RG353 devices (requires porting of DSI controller driver and DSI-DPHY driver to send DSI commands to the panel).
